Lever’s Histopathology of the Skin is a classic, authoritative reference in dermatopathology, widely used by dermatologists, pathologists, and trainees. It provides a comprehensive, pathophysiology-based organization of skin diseases, building on Walter Lever’s original scheme. The text integrates clinical and histopathologic perspectives, allowing for a deeper understanding of skin disorders and aiding in accurate diagnosis.
